What is Biofeedback?

Biofeedback is a mind-body technique that involves monitoring physiological processes such as heart rate, muscle tension, and skin temperature, and providing real-time feedback to help individuals learn how to control these processes. By becoming more aware of their body’s responses, individuals can learn to regulate these processes through relaxation techniques, breathing exercises, and other self-regulation strategies.
